
Micro-Frontend Architecture: Scaling Large-Scale Web Applications.
📚What You Will Learn
📝Summary
ℹ️Quick Facts
đź’ˇKey Takeaways
Micro-frontends extend microservices to the UI, splitting web apps into small, independent pieces owned by dedicated teams. Each piece—like a cart or dashboard—can be built, tested, and deployed separately. This mirrors backend modularity but focuses on user-facing HTML.
Unlike monolithic frontends, where one change rebuilds everything, micro-frontends let teams work autonomously with their preferred tech stacks. In 2026, they're key for large-scale apps handling complex workflows.
Teams gain autonomy, deploying features without waiting on others, which accelerates iteration and reduces bottlenecks. Enterprises build process-driven apps faster, with reusable components for payments or case management.
Smaller codebases mean easier navigation, fewer mistakes, and better maintainability—crucial for long-term projects. Plus, create role-specific views quickly, enhancing user experiences.
Technology flexibility shines during migrations, like shifting from Angular to React incrementally. Reusability cuts development time across multiple apps.
Integrate via frameworks like Module Federation or Single-SPA, composing micro-frontends at runtime or build time. For example, a checkout team updates UI without redeploying the whole site.
Vertical teams handle full-stack features end-to-end, breaking silos between frontend and backend devs. This supports continuous releases and safe rollbacks.